From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Armand Kali(s)z (October 23, 1882 or 1883 - February 1, 1941) was a French born American film actor of the silent film and early sound period of the 1930s. Born in Paris, or in Warsaw, Poland Kaliz was a headliner in vaudeville. He arrived in the USA in 1907. His Broadway debut came in The Hoyden (1907). His other plays on Broadway included The Kiss Burglar (1918) and Spice of 1922 (1922). He appeared in films such as The Temptress (1926) with actresses such as Greta Garbo, making some 82 film appearances between 1917 and 1941. After 1933, the majority of his small roles in films went uncredited.
